I don't think MM sells LCA's with urethane bushing on both ends. Their 2 options are urethane bushings on body side w/ spherical on axle end, and spherical on both ends. I'd suggest the urethane/spherical LCA's, I have them and love them. I think spherical bushings on both ends would be too rough and loud for a street car.
